WDRT is committed to: informing listeners of local and state events and community happenings entertaining and engaging the public by offering a broad mix of programming that reflects the heritage and diversity of … WebAug 17, 2024 · Ten thousand years ago, the Ice Age took a detour around southwestern Wisconsin. That’s why it’s called the Driftless Area.Without the glacial deposits of rock, clay, sand and silt called drift that flattened the rest of the upper Midwest, this region’s winding backroads reveal picturesque limestone bluffs, spring-fed waterfalls, blue-ribbon … čarobnjak iz oza cijeli film

WebThe “Driftless Area” of the upper Mississippi River valley is the unglaciated region of the upper midwest. While glaciers encroached on the region from north, west, and east, the karst geology of the region is thought to have limited the flow of glacial ice during the most recent (Wisconsinan) glaciation over what is now parts of four states bordering the …

Webdrain approximately 300 km2 of the Wisconsin Driftless Division (herein after Driftless area). The Driftless area encompasses an area of nearly 35,000 km2, and was surrounded on three sides but never covered by late Pleistocene glacial ice.
